House Bill 5188 of 2003 (Public Act 214 of 2003)

Sponsors

Categories

Public utilities: consumer services
Public utilities; consumer services; waiver from requirements of the code of conduct for utility appliance service programs; extend. Amends sec. 10a of 1939 PA 3 (MCL 460.10a).

History

(House actions in lowercase, Senate actions in UPPERCASE)
Note: A page number of 0 indicates that the page number is coming soon
Date Journal Action
10/21/2003 HJ 77 Pg. 1953 referred to Committee on Energy and Technology
11/05/2003 HJ 84 Pg. 2079 reported with recommendation with substitute H-2
11/05/2003 HJ 84 Pg. 2079 referred to second reading
11/06/2003 HJ 85 Pg. 2084 substitute H-2 adopted and amended
11/06/2003 HJ 85 Pg. 2084 placed on third reading
11/06/2003 HJ 85 Pg. 2084 placed on immediate passage
11/06/2003 HJ 85 Pg. 2084 passed; given immediate effect Roll Call # 610 Yeas 104 Nays 0
11/06/2003 HJ 85 Pg. 2091 vote on passage reconsidered
11/06/2003 HJ 85 Pg. 2091 passed Roll Call # 615 Yeas 106 Nays 0
11/12/2003 SJ 96 Pg. 2035 REFERRED TO COMMITTEE OF THE WHOLE
11/12/2003 SJ 96 Pg. 2036 REPORTED BY COMMITTEE OF THE WHOLE FAVORABLY WITHOUT AMENDMENT(S)
11/12/2003 SJ 96 Pg. 2036 PLACED ON ORDER OF THIRD READING
11/12/2003 SJ 96 Pg. 2047 PLACED ON IMMEDIATE PASSAGE
11/12/2003 SJ 96 Pg. 2053 PASSED; GIVEN IMMEDIATE EFFECT ROLL CALL # 555 YEAS 38 NAYS 0 EXCUSED 0 NOT VOTING 0
11/12/2003 HJ 86 Pg. 2168 bill ordered enrolled
12/02/2003 HJ 88 Pg. 2200 presented to the Governor 11/18/2003 @ 3:26 PM
12/02/2003 HJ 88 Pg. 2205 approved by the Governor 12/1/2003 @ 4:05 PM
12/02/2003 HJ 88 Pg. 2205 filed with Secretary of State 12/2/2003 @ 10:08 AM
12/02/2003 HJ 88 Pg. 2205 assigned PA 214'03 with immediate effect
